What is the difference between Offshore CPA vs Onshore CPA?

AspectOffshore CPAOnshore CPA
CredentialsCPA certification, similar to onshoreCPA certification, similar to offshore
Work EnvironmentRemote, often in different time zonesOn-site or local office
Employer & IndustryGlobal firms, outsourcing companiesLocal accounting firms, corporations
Work FocusTax, audit, bookkeeping for international clientsTax, audit, consulting for local clients

Offshore CPAs and Onshore CPAs both hold CPA credentials and perform similar accounting tasks. The main difference lies in their work environment and client base: offshore CPAs typically work remotely for international clients from different time zones, while onshore CPAs work locally in offices. Both roles are vital in the accounting industry, serving different market needs.

Position Summary

The Staff Accountant is responsible for maintaining accurate financial records and supporting the period-end close, performing account reconciliations, preparing journal entries, and managing accounting activities related to capital projects. This role requires strong attention to detail, analytical skills, and the ability to work collaboratively across the Finance department and cross-functionally with project managers.

Essential Responsibilities:

  • Prepare and post journal entries, including accruals, adjustments, and recurring entries
  • Perform period-end financial close activities, including ERP module closes and the generation of various key system reports
  • Prepare balance sheet account reconciliations and supporting analyses
  • Manage the full accounting lifecycle of capital expenditures: project setup, tracking expenditures and status, placing completed projects into service with the appropriate asset class and depreciable lives, and preparing fixed asset rollforwards and account reconciliations at period end
  • Partner with Treasury to review and verify subledger postings, resolve coding errors, and ensure accurate plant-level tracking
  • Assist with inventory management, including managing physical inventory counts, properly accounting for consigned inventory and perpetual inventories
  • Maintain organized accounting records and ensure compliance with GAAP, company policies and internal controls
  • Support compliance with internal controls and Sarbanes-Oxley 404 (SOX) testing
  • Assist in the fulfillment of internal and external audit requests.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to gather information needed for financial reporting and process evaluations 
  • Support process improvement initiatives aimed at enhancing the efficiency, accuracy, and consistency of accounting and reporting practices.
  • Provide support for ad hoc financial analysis as needed
